The short version

Population has fallen 37% since 2019, a loss of 66 residents. 2%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, below the national rate of 33%.

Frequently asked

How many people live in Rosine, Kentucky?

Rosine, Kentucky has about 110 residents according to the 2020 American Community Survey.

Is Rosine, Kentucky expensive?

In Rosine, Kentucky, the median home is worth about $40,300.

How educated are people in Rosine, Kentucky?

About 2.3% of adults age 25 and over in Rosine, Kentucky hold a bachelor's degree or higher.

What is the poverty rate in Rosine, Kentucky?

About 17.0% of people in Rosine, Kentucky live below the federal poverty line.
